About the role:
Active Care Group is hiring a motivated Support Worker to join our dedicated team, assisting our male client at home and in the community.
The successful candidate will play a vital role in understanding and supporting our client's journey with brain injury. This involves learning about his goals, addressing challenges, and fostering effective communication to meet his specific needs. Your role extends to assisting him in selecting meaningful daily activities.
Despite daily challenges, our client maintains interests in sports, music, concerts, and dining out. A valid UK driving license is essential for driving his car during community outings.
Given that our client is a wheelchair user, you will learn mobility techniques through training provided by experienced team members, with continuous training for ongoing skill development.
Our client will welcome you into his spacious home near the sea and looks forward to your support in enjoying his house and garden with him. Join our team and make a meaningful impact in enhancing the quality of our client's life.
No previous experience required as full training, shadow shifts, and ongoing support will be provided.
